Cost of Walkway Enlargement in Ankeny
Expanding a walkway in Ankeny, IA, can be a valuable investment for homeowners looking to enhance their property's curb appeal and functionality. However, the cost of such a project can vary widely based on several factors. Understanding these factors and common tasks involved can help you budget more effectively.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Choice: The type of material used, such as concrete, brick, or pavers, significantly influences the overall cost.
- Walkway Size: Larger walkways require more materials and labor, increasing the cost.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Ankeny, IA, can vary based on the contractor's experience and the complexity of the project.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all expense.
- Site Preparation: The condition of the existing site, including any necessary excavation or grading, can affect costs.
- Design Complexity: Intricate designs or custom features like curves and patterns can increase labor and material costs.
- Additional Features: Adding elements like lighting, edging, or landscaping will add to the total c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Ankeny, IA) |
---|---|
Basic Concrete Walkway | $6 - $10 per square foot |
Brick Paver Walkway | $10 - $20 per square foot |
Excavation and Grading |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Permit Fees | $50 - $200 |
Custom Design Features | $500 - $2,000 |
Lighting Installation | $300 - $1,000 |
Landscaping Enhancements | $500 - $2,500 |
